ABOUT SOCIETE GENERALE:

Société Générale Corporate Investment Banking (SGCIB) is one of the largest investment banks in the world and is present in more than 75 countries. The head office of its Canadian entities is located in Montreal.

In Canada, Société Générale operations include financial services (with a regulated investment dealer, and a regulated foreign bank branch), business advisory, as well as the execution and clearing of exchange traded securities and derivatives.

Société Générale Group was established in Canada in 1974 and has today more than 825employees and consultants based in its Montreal and Toronto offices.

ABOUT THE DEPARTMENT:

The Compliance Department at Société Générale Canada is responsible for overseeing compliance with laws, regulations, guidelines and policies that apply to the firm’s banking and financial activities (including securities dealings), particularly in the areas of anti-money laundering, anti-terrorism financing, sanctions embargoes, know-your-customer obligations, client protection, market integrity, anti-bribery corruption, data protection and client tax transparency.

The Compliance Department enables the firm to operate according to essential compliance standards, ensures that Société Générale’s non-compliance and reputational risks are controlled, while supporting the business with existing activities and in the development of new products or services.

Compliance acts as a second line of defense, developing and implementing policies, procedures and controls, monitoring activities, advising the business, assessing risks, and providing training to ensure understanding and application of requirements, contributing to spread a culture of compliance within the Société Générale Group.

ABOUT THE JOB:

The role of the SG Canada CCO is to ensure the organization meets all regulatory obligations and adheres to internal policies. The role is a full-time job with a mandatory four days in the office per week.
• Leadership and Team Management:
• Strategically enhance the SG Canada compliance risk management framework on an ongoing basis, serving as a member of the SG Canada Executive Committee.
• Supervise a team of approximately 47 compliance professionals based in Montreal, fostering a culture of compliance across the organization.
• Work closely with colleagues in SG New York and across the Americas region.
• Regulatory Compliance:
• Establish and maintain robust policies and procedures to assess adherence to applicable laws and regulations, ensuring the firm and its representatives operate within established guidelines.
• Monitor compliance activities and promptly escalate any non-compliance issues.
• Reporting and Oversight:
• Prepare and submit an annual compliance report to the SG Canada board of directors or equivalent governing body, facilitating assessments of compliance with the Corporation’s Dealer Member rules and relevant securities laws.
• Compliance Culture Promotion:
• Collaborate on the development and dissemination of policies and procedures.
• Lead educational initiatives to enhance employee awareness and adherence to compliance standards.
• Proactive Compliance Programs:
• Design and implement proactive programs to detect compliance violations, including the evaluation and integration of relevant software solutions.
• Regulatory Relations:
• Build and maintain strong relationships with regulatory bodies and self-regulatory organizations (such as CIRO and the Montreal Exchange), ensuring full cooperation during inspections and investigations.

By cultivating a culture of compliance, the CCO safeguards the institution's reputation and aligns compliance efforts with the bank's long-term strategic objectives.
